Inclusion Criteria

1. Patients in septic shock

2. Consent for participation from guardian

3. Patients with central venous line insitu

Exclusion Criteria

1. Declined consent from the guardian

2. Pregnant patient

3. Patients with pre existing liver or kidney disease

4. Patients with incomplete data.

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
The relationship between the P(cv-a)CO2/D(a-cv)O2 ratio and lactate clearanceTimepoint: The relationship between the P(cv-a)CO2/D(a-cv)O2 ratio and lactate clearance at baseline, 8 hours and 24 hours.
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
To define a cut offvalue for the P(cv-a)CO2/D(a-cv)O2 ratio to identify lactate clearance at 8 & 24 hrs respectively after resuscitationTimepoint: 8 hrs and 24 hrs
